This episode focuses on the Hetet Homestead, home to famous weavers and cultural advocates Dame Rangimārie Hetet and her daughter Diggeress Te Kawana. They were both celebrated for their mastery of traditional Māori weaving Techniques.

Stories of homesteads through the eyes of the ahi kā that are maintaining and strengthening Māori ties to their tūrangawaewae.
